an acceptable alternative
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"an acceptable alternative"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when discussing options or choices that are deemed satisfactory or suitable in a particular context. Example: "While there are many options available, using public transportation is an acceptable alternative to driving."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When presenting options, use "an acceptable alternative" to clearly indicate that the proposed substitute is satisfactory and meets the necessary requirements. Make sure the alternative is genuinely viable in the given context.
Common error
Avoid using "an acceptable alternative" when the proposed option is clearly inferior or does not adequately fulfill the original's purpose. Misrepresenting the quality of the alternative can undermine your credibility.

More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
a viable substitute
Focuses on the practicality and workability of the replacement.
a reasonable option
Emphasizes the logical and sensible nature of the choice.
a satisfactory replacement
Highlights that the substitute adequately fulfills the original's function.
a suitable stand-in
Suggests a temporary or less ideal, but still adequate, replacement.
an adequate substitute
Indicates the replacement meets the minimum requirements or expectations.
a fitting substitute
Emphasizes the appropriateness of the replacement for the given context.
a permissible option
Implies that the alternative is allowed or officially approved.
a tolerable replacement
Suggests the replacement is not ideal but can be endured or accepted.
a valid option
Focuses on the legitimacy and defensibility of the choice.
a working substitute
Emphasizes that the substitute functions effectively, even if not perfectly.
FAQs
How can I effectively use "an acceptable alternative" in a sentence?
Use "an acceptable alternative" to introduce a substitute or option that meets the necessary requirements. For example, "If the primary method fails, this is "an acceptable alternative"."
What are some phrases similar to "an acceptable alternative"?
You can use phrases like "a viable option", "a suitable substitute", or "a reasonable alternative" depending on the specific nuance you want to convey. Consider the context to choose the most fitting phrase.
When is it appropriate to use "an acceptable alternative" over other similar phrases?
Use "an acceptable alternative" when you want to emphasize that the proposed substitute is not just any option, but one that meets the required standards and is genuinely satisfactory. This distinguishes it from options that might be less desirable or effective.
Is there a difference between "an acceptable alternative" and "an agreeable alternative"?
"An acceptable alternative" implies that the option meets the necessary standards or requirements, while "an agreeable alternative" suggests that the option is pleasing or suitable to those involved. The former focuses on suitability, the latter on palatability. You can use alternative like "a viable option", "a suitable substitute" or "a reasonable alternative".
